The Pohutukawa Cottage...Tranquil and Unusual

Quirky cottage completely renovated using as many recycled materials as possible with some special touches. Recycled materials were used from The Art Deco Mayfair threatre in Kaikoura. Also materials used from The Adelphi Hotel built in 1918. Kitchen custom made out of recycled cross arms off power polls and various other native timbers. Modern conveniences with stacks of retro and rustic charm. Enjoy a hot outdoor bath with a view to the mountains and two minutes walk to the beach.
